A total of seven patients were tested positive of dengue in the city on Monday. Of these four patients are from Ludhiana and one each from Sangrur, Hoshiarpur and Fardikot.

A 40-year-old man from Mahavir Jain Colony, a 18-year-old girl from Iqbal Nagar, 27-year-old man from Tibba Road and eight-year-old boy from Tajpur Road of Ludhiana were confirmed of dengue and are admitted at Christian Medical College and Hospital.

A 46-year-old man from Sangrur, a 20-year-old boy from Hoshiarpur and 59-year-old man from Faridkot, who were tested positive of dengue, are undergoing treatment at Dayanand Medical College and Hospital.

Now, the total number of dengue patients has reached to 182 in city hospitals, out of which 135 patients belong to Ludhiana, 41 belonged to other districts of Punjab and six are from other states.
